I have been off and on using this site dont post very often so I thought I would throw up some photos of the truck. Its actually not mine its the Girlfriends truck.






Specs on it for you guys.
-Lowered 4/5 soon to be 4/6 or 7 after I notch the frame.
-24" Giovanna Canelli rims with 275/30R24 Nitto Invo tires.
-Street Scene Cal-vu mirrors manual to electric conversion.
-Street Scene Smooth Wiper Cowl.
-Anzo Headlights. Soon to be changed...
-Black LED taillights that have been smoked out.
-All plastic pieces painted body colour.
-Emblems painted body colour.
-FX2 Valance.
-Black Trex Billet Grills.
-Edge Evolution Programmer.
-Airaid Intake.
-Flowmaster 40 Series Exhaust.

There are lots of other things coming very soon. I will keep you guys posted.
